Module: Sfn

Defined in:
lib/sfn/aws_cli.rb,
lib/sfn/execution.rb,
lib/sfn/mock_data.rb,
lib/sfn/collection.rb,
lib/sfn/mock_macros.rb,
lib/sfn/configuration.rb,
lib/sfn/execution_log.rb,
lib/sfn/state_machine.rb,
lib/sfn/mock_macros/sns.rb,
lib/sfn/mock_macros/sqs.rb,
lib/sfn/mock_macros/lambda.rb,
lib/sfn/mock_macros/api_gateway.rb,
lib/sfn/mock_macros/step_function.rb,
lib/sfn/mock_macros/sdk_integration.rb,
lib/sfn/mock_macros/secrets_manager.rb,
lib/sfn/mock_macros/native_integration.rb,
lib/sfn/mock_macros/optimised_step_function.rb

Defined Under Namespace

Modules: MockData, MockMacros Classes: AwsCli, Collection, DefinitionError, Execution, ExecutionError, ExecutionLog, StateMachine

Class Method Summary collapse

Class Method Details

.configurationObject



5
6
7
# File 'lib/sfn/configuration.rb', line 5

def self.configuration
  @configuration ||= OpenStruct.new
end

.configure {|configuration| ... } ⇒ Object

Yields:



9
10
11
# File 'lib/sfn/configuration.rb', line 9

def self.configure
  yield(configuration)
end